Is this something that RacePak would be willing to look at?

My previous data logger did this by detecting the car launching from a standing start (speed and G's), then used the start/finish line that was programmed in as the "finish" - giving you a lap time.

Is thing something that could be added to the firmware?
Would be useful for hillclimb type events and I guess drags, tractor pulling etc.
